#ef7c35 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ef7c35 is composed of 93.7% red, 48.6%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.1% magenta, 77.8%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 22.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 57.3%. #ef7c35 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ff86a with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

Shades and Tints of #ef7c35

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100701 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ef7c35

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#939291 is the less saturated color, while #f77a2d is the most saturated one.
